Introduction to Management
Crawley - 12th & 13th March 2012 (2 Days)
Content:
Over 2 days, you will be guided through stages designed to improve your management skills. These will be interactive with various tasks that will focus on the following:
Your Role as Manager
• Characteristics which make a good manager
• Balancing the needs of tasks, people and self
• Theory X and Y
• Kolb Learning Cycle
Task management
• PACE model
• Terms of reference
• Objectives – SMART and OSCA
Planning Skills
• Constructing a plan
• Monitoring costs and resources
• Guided or misguided assumptions
• Practical planning
Situational Management
• Skill / Will model
• Selecting the correct management style
Managing Teams
• What / who is your team?
• Benefits and Disadvantages
• Stages of development
• Understanding team roles
Personal Style
• Impacts of style
• Power of versatility
Motivation
• Herzberg and Maslow models
Participants:
The Introduction to Management course is aimed towards employees who have recently, or are just about to embark upon their managerial career.
Course Objectives:
On completion of this course you will be fully informed of the fundamental skills involved in managing tasks, people and yourself. You will also be in a position to implement these skills into your day to day operations.
